Another fire at an abandoned apartment complex in Shreveport. This latest fire happened at the Jolie Apartments just off of Shreveport Barksdale Highway on Quail Creek shortly before midnight.

Firefighters arrived in less than five minutes of getting the call and found heavy flames and smoke coming from several units in one of the apartment buildings.

Shreveport fire dispatched 12 units to the scene to put this blaze out. More than two
dozen firefighters tackled the fire and they were able to bring it under control.

The apartment complex remains vacant and no one is supposed to be in the complex. It is clearly marked and there is a gate across the roadway to the entrance of the property. Investigators suspect vagrants might have started the blaze, but we don't know why. No one was hurt in the fire and all firefighters are also ok.

The cause of the fire remains under investigation by the Shreveport Fire
Department’s Fire Prevention Bureau.

The Shreveport Fire Department reminds citizens that if you observe any
suspicious activity around vacant property, please contact the Shreveport Police
Department immediately.
